DCM Data Signal Circuit between Navigation ECU and DCM [12/2017 - 10/2020]: Procedure
- CHECK HARNESS AND CONNECTOR (RADIO RECEIVER ASSEMBLY - ANTENNA CORD SUB-ASSEMBLY [I/P])
- Disconnect the G53 radio receiver assembly connector.
- Disconnect the GG3 antenna cord sub-assembly (I/P) connector.
- Measure the resistance according to the value(s) in the table below.
Standard Resistance
Tester Connection Condition Specified Condition G53-10 (USBV) - GG3-5 (USBV) Always Below 1 Ω G53-11 (USBG) - GG3-3 (USBG) Always Below 1 Ω G53-15 (VOT+) - GG3-8 (VOR+) Always Below 1 Ω G53-16 (VOT-) - GG3-7 (VOR-) Always Below 1 Ω G53-13 (VOR+) - GG3-4 (VOT+) Always Below 1 Ω G53-14 (VOR-) - GG3-6 (VOT-) Always Below 1 Ω G53-12 (SGND) - GG3-1 (SG) Always Below 1 Ω G53-10 (USBV) - Body ground Always 10 kΩ or higher G53-11 (USBG) - Body ground Always 10 kΩ or higher G53-15 (VOT+) - Body ground Always 10 kΩ or higher G53-16 (VOT-) - Body ground Always 10 kΩ or higher G53-13 (VOR+) - Body ground Always 10 kΩ or higher G53-14 (VOR-) - Body ground Always 10 kΩ or higher G53-12 (SGND) - Body ground Always 10 kΩ or higher Result
Proceed to OK NG
Result:
NG
REPAIR OR REPLACE HARNESS OR CONNECTOR
Result:
OK
See step 2
- CHECK ANTENNA CORD SUB-ASSEMBLY (I/P)
- Disconnect the antenna connector from the DCM (telematics transceiver).
*a Front view of wire harness connector
(to DCM [Telematics Transceiver])*b Front view of wire harness connector
(to Wire Harness) - Disconnect the antenna connector from the wire harness.
- Measure the resistance according to the value(s) in the table below.
Standard Resistance
Tester Connection Condition Specified Condition G131-3 (USBV) - GG3-5 (USBV) Always Below 1 Ω G131-1 (USBG) - GG3-3 (USBG) Always Below 1 Ω G131-9 (VOR+) - GG3-8 (VOR+) Always Below 1 Ω G131-8 (VOR-) - GG3-7 (VOR-) Always Below 1 Ω G131-2 (VOT+) - GG3-4 (VOT+) Always Below 1 Ω G131-7 (VOT-) - GG3-6 (VOT-) Always Below 1 Ω G131-3 (USBV) - Body ground Always 10 kΩ or higher G131-1 (USBG) - Body ground Always 10 kΩ or higher G131-9 (VOR+) - Body ground Always 10 kΩ or higher G131-8 (VOR-) - Body ground Always 10 kΩ or higher G131-2 (VOT+) - Body ground Always 10 kΩ or higher G131-7 (VOT-) - Body ground Always 10 kΩ or higher Result
Proceed to OK NG
Result:
NG
REPLACE ANTENNA CORD SUB-ASSEMBLY (I/P). Refer to REMOVAL [12/2017 - 09/2018] , or refer to REMOVAL [09/2018 - 10/2020]
Result:
OK
See step 3

- CHECK ANTENNA CORD SUB-ASSEMBLY (I/P)
- Disconnect the antenna connector from the DCM (telematics transceiver).
*a Front view of wire harness connector
(to DCM [Telematics Transceiver])*b Front view of wire harness connector
(to Navigation ECU) - Disconnect the antenna connector from the navigation ECU.
- Measure the resistance according to the value(s) in the table below.
Standard Resistance
Tester Connection Condition Specified Condition G131-5 (USB+) - G135-1 (USB+) Always Below 1 Ω G131-4 (USB-) - G135-2 (USB-) Always Below 1 Ω G131-6 (USBS) - G135-3 (USBS) Always Below 1 Ω G131-5 (USB+) - Body ground Always 10 kΩ or higher G131-4 (USB-) - Body ground Always 10 kΩ or higher G131-6 (USBS) - Body ground Always 10 kΩ or higher Result
Proceed to OK NG
Result:
OK
PROCEED TO NEXT SUSPECTED AREA SHOWN IN PROBLEM SYMPTOMS TABLE. Refer to PROBLEM SYMPTOMS TABLE [12/2017 - 10/2020]
Result:
NG
REPLACE ANTENNA CORD SUB-ASSEMBLY (I/P). Refer to REMOVAL [12/2017 - 09/2018] , or refer to REMOVAL [09/2018 - 10/2020]
